摘要
Soluble poly[(1,3-phenyleneethynylene)-alt-tris(2,5-dialkoxy-1,4-phenyleneethynylene)] derivatives (5) have been synthesized by using the Heck-type coupling reaction. Even with a significant increase in the p-phenyleneethynylene content, the copolymers exhibit a random-coil conformation in THF solution, with a Mark-Houwink exponent determined to be a approximate to 0.78. As a result of the extended conjugation length of the chromophore, the absorption and emission lambda(max) values of 5 are notably red-shifted (by about 30-40 nm) from that of poly[(1,3-phenyleneethynylene)-alt-(2,5-dialkoxy-1,4-phenyleneethynylene)] derivatives (2). The fluorescence quantum efficiency of 5 is estimated to be phi(fl) approximate to 0.50, slightly higher than that of 2 (phi(fl) approximate to 0.44). The fluorescence of 5 in the solid state is strong, indicating its potential for various device applications. LEDs based on 5 emitted green-yellow EL with an external quantum efficiency of 0.013%.
